Huawei Smart Urban Rail Summit: Revolutionizing Urban Transit
On May 11, 2025, Huawei hosted the Smart Urban Rail Summit in Hong Kong, focusing on the theme "Steaming Ahead with Cloud-Network Convergence and Data & AI Enablement for Smart Urban Rail." This event gathered experts and industry leaders to discuss how innovative technologies can transform urban rail systems worldwide.
Key Highlights of the Summit
Thomas Xu, the Vice President of Huawei's Smart Transportation Division, opened the summit by emphasizing the necessity for integrating appropriate information and digital technologies tailored to specific service needs. His insights outlined that successful urban transit management relies on employing cutting-edge solutions.
Dr. Tony Lee Kar-yun, Operations and Innovation Director at MTR, discussed the potential of merging digital resources and AI applications to enhance operational efficiency and improve passenger experiences. He noted that this technological integration lays the groundwork for efficient urban transport and contributes to a more comfortable community lifestyle.
Xi Xiaodong, Chief Engineer at Shanghai Rail Transit Maintenance Support Co., highlighted that metro services must blend external resources with their internal core capabilities to achieve quality development. This perspective underscores the importance of collaboration between various stakeholders in the urban transport sector.
On the technical side, Nelson Huang, Director of Railway Operations at Huawei's Smart Transportation Division, presented Huawei's approach in merging advanced information and communication technology. This includes leveraging cloud computing, big data, 5G, AI, and IoT for the enhancement of urban rail systems. The objective, as outlined by Huang, is to establish a digital and intelligent foundation that supports urban railway networks.
The discussions continued with key figures such as Xiong Xinbin, rotating CEO of the Beijing Railway Institute of Mechanical Electrical Engineering, who mentioned employing Huawei's Pangu models to strengthen rail transport capabilities. He explained how they are using Ascend and Kunpeng to lay a robust data foundation and the integration of AI to develop a comprehensive intelligent operation management platform.

Huawei's involvement in urban rail spans more than 300 urban rail lines across over 70 cities worldwide. The company is now focusing on deepening its collaboration with industry partners, adhering to the principles of openness, cooperation, and shared success. Their commitment extends beyond digital and intelligent transportation; Huawei aims to facilitate smoother travel experiences and logistics as urban populations expand.
